1. Origins and Geological Formation of Amber

Amber is fossilized resin from ancient coniferous trees that lived millions of years ago, typically during the Cretaceous and Paleogene periods (approximately 30 to 90 million years ago). This resin was exuded by trees as a defense mechanism against injury and infection, eventually undergoing polymerization and hardening through geological processes to become amber.

Significant amber deposits are found around the world, notably in:

  • The Baltic Region: Home to the largest and most commercially significant amber deposits, often called Baltic amber, dating back around 44 million years.
  • Dominican Republic: Known for its clear, often blue-hued amber, rich in well-preserved insect inclusions.
  • Mexico, Myanmar, and Lebanon: Other notable sources offering unique varieties of amber.

Amber’s formation involves complex natural factors such as temperature, pressure, and environmental conditions, which influence its clarity, color, and inclusions. This geological legacy makes amber not only a precious material but also a natural time capsule preserving prehistoric ecosystems.

2. Unique Physical and Chemical Properties of Amber

Amber’s distinctive characteristics contribute to its value and usability in various applications:

  • Color Variability: Amber exhibits a spectrum of colors ranging from honey-gold, orange, and red to rare green, blue, and black varieties. This color diversity is often influenced by the original resin source and environmental conditions.

  • Lightweight and Durable: Despite being an organic material, amber is surprisingly tough and durable, with a Mohs hardness rating between 2 and 2.5. Its low density makes it comfortable for wearable art like jewelry.

  • Electrostatic Effect: Historically, amber was noted for generating static electricity when rubbed — a property that fascinated ancient civilizations and is the origin of the word "electricity" (from the Greek word for amber, ἤλεκτρον, elektron).

  • Inclusions: One of amber’s most prized features is its ability to trap and preserve ancient organisms such as insects, arachnids, and plant matter in remarkable detail, offering invaluable scientific insights.

  • Thermal Insulation: Amber has natural insulating properties against heat and electricity, making it a unique material in certain artisanal and scientific uses.

3. Diverse Uses of Amber in Modern Industries

Jewelry and Fashion

Amber has been treasured as a gemstone and ornamental material for millennia:

  • Used to craft necklaces, rings, earrings, and beads, amber jewelry is prized for its warm hues and natural inclusions.
  • Its lightweight nature makes it a favored choice for statement pieces that are comfortable to wear.
  • Polished amber is also used in artisan crafts and decorative objects.

Scientific and Historical Research

  • Amber acts as a natural preservative for prehistoric life forms, aiding paleontologists and archaeologists in studying ancient ecosystems and evolutionary biology.
  • Inclusions in amber provide some of the clearest and most detailed fossil records of insects, plants, and microorganisms.
  • Amber’s chemical properties have been studied to understand polymerization and natural preservation mechanisms.

Alternative Medicine and Cultural Practices

  • Historically, amber was believed to possess healing and protective properties, often worn as amulets or used in traditional medicine.
  • Today, amber oil and beads are still used in holistic therapies and alternative wellness practices.

4. Environmental, Cultural, and Economic Importance

Amber is not only a precious natural material but also one with significant cultural and environmental impact:

  • Sustainable Sourcing: Responsible extraction methods ensure amber mining minimizes environmental disruption, preserving forest ecosystems and respecting local communities.
  • Cultural Heritage: Amber has played a vital role in many cultures, from ancient Baltic tribes to Mediterranean civilizations, symbolizing beauty, protection, and status.
  • Economic Value: The global amber market supports artisan crafts, jewelry industries, and scientific research, contributing to local economies in producing regions.
  • Scientific Legacy: Amber’s preservation of ancient life forms helps unlock Earth’s evolutionary history, making it invaluable to science and education.
